WordPress登录页面优化指南,提升用户体验与安全性

来自:安企建站服务研究院

头像 方知笔记
2026年01月02日 21:12

WordPress作为全球最流行的内容管理系统,其登录页面是网站管理员和用户每天都要接触的重要入口。一个设计合理、功能完善的WordPress登录页面不仅能提升用户体验,还能有效增强网站安全性。本文将详细介绍WordPress登录页面的各项功能及优化方法。

一、WordPress默认登录页面解析

WordPress默认登录页面通常位于”yoursite.com/wp-login.php”或”yoursite.com/wp-admin”。这个页面包含以下核心元素:

  1. 用户名/邮箱输入框
  2. 密码输入框
  3. 记住我选项
  4. 登录按钮
  5. 找回密码链接
  6. 返回网站链接

虽然功能完整,但默认界面设计较为简单,缺乏品牌特色,这也是许多站长选择自定义登录页面的原因。

二、自定义登录页面的实用方法

1. 通过插件快速美化

对于不熟悉代码的用户,可以使用专业插件来自定义登录页面:

  • Theme My Login:提供完整的登录页面定制功能
  • Custom Login Page Customizer:可视化编辑登录页面
  • LoginPress:提供多种预设模板和自定义选项

这些插件通常允许用户更改背景、logo、配色方案等元素,无需编写代码即可实现专业效果。

2. 代码级自定义方法

对于开发人员,可以通过在主题的functions.php文件中添加代码来实现更精细的控制:

// 修改登录页面logo
function custom_login_logo() {
echo '<style type="text/css">
h1 a { background-image:url('.get_bloginfo('template_directory').'/images/custom-logo.png) !important; }
</style>';
}
add_action('login_head', 'custom_login_logo');

类似的方法还可以用来修改登录页面的背景、链接颜色、表单样式等各种元素。

三、登录页面安全强化措施

WordPress登录页面是黑客攻击的主要目标,强化其安全性至关重要:

  1. 限制登录尝试:使用插件如Limit Login Attempts Reloaded防止暴力破解
  2. 启用双因素认证:Google Authenticator等插件可增加第二层验证
  3. 修改默认登录地址:通过插件或.htaccess文件更改/wp-admin路径
  4. 使用SSL加密:确保登录过程数据加密传输
  5. 定期更新:保持WordPress核心、主题和插件为最新版本

四、提升登录页面用户体验的技巧

  1. 添加社交媒体登录选项:使用Nextend Social Login等插件允许用户通过社交账号登录
  2. 简化表单设计:减少不必要的字段,使登录过程更流畅
  3. 添加帮助文本:对密码要求等提供明确说明
  4. 优化移动端体验:确保登录表单在各种设备上都能正常显示和使用
  5. 多语言支持:为国际化用户提供本地化登录界面

五、常见问题解决方案

  1. 忘记密码:确保”找回密码”功能正常工作,可考虑添加额外的安全问答
  2. 登录重定向问题:检查.htaccess文件和插件设置
  3. 白屏死机:通常由内存不足引起,可尝试增加WP_MEMORY_LIMIT
  4. cookie错误:检查浏览器设置和网站域名配置

结语

WordPress登录页面作为网站的重要门户,值得投入时间进行优化和强化。无论是通过插件还是自定义代码,创建一个既安全又用户友好的登录界面,都能为网站带来实质性的提升。建议定期审查登录页面的性能和安全性,确保其始终处于最佳状态。